2023: (3.5 stars) While a return visit to Fich didn’t quite live up to my memories of the first time, it does remain a suburban fish’n’chips shop you’d probably be happy to call your local. With their attention split between takeaway and dine-in, staff can be a bit hard to catch, but when it lands, your Negroni ($15) will be strong and satisfying. Despite a set sharing menu ($60/head) we opted to construct our own meal of small plates plucked from both the chalkboard specials and the regular menu.From the blackboard, scallop tostada ($7/each) teamed tiny scallops with celery leaf, tomato salsa and onion on corn-based crisps. More meaty Hervey Bay scallops ($7/each) sit like white eggs on birds’ nests of egg noodles with garlic, shallots and seaweed butter. While the blackboard’s last gasp of summer lettuce-wrapped prawn tacos ($10/each) with mango salsa were great, the menu’s raw tacos ($8/each) lost the salmon in a hectic mix of crunchy purple cabbage, crispy corn, lettuce and lashings of coriander dressing. I was also a little disappointed with muted bacalhau croquettes ($5/each) expecting more salt cod oomph from a place of Portuguese origin: Fich is owned by the same team as Sweet Belem and Luna’s Petersham. Their kingfish crudo ($24) on the other hand was both colourful and tasty with tart passionfruit, cucumber, bright red chilli, pickled onion and fat crisp corn kernels for texture.2021: (4 stars) With a split business model that is perfect for the COVIDSafe milieu we find ourselves within, Fich at Petersham is your contemporary neighbourhood fish’n’chippie. It’s one part takeaway fish and chips shop, the other part smart casual seafood restaurant. Co-owned by Jose Silva, Fich is also somewhere where you can get your Sweet Belem Portuguese tart ($6) fix when his popular bakery up the road is closed.The menu, supplemented by chalkboard specials, is divided into snacks, shares and grilled fish fillets. We kick off with Coffin Bay Oysters ($48/dozen) too quick and devoid of liquor to have been shucked to order, but tasty when lubricated with lemon & looking the part with the best oyster plating I’ve seen in ages! Continuing the drive to put potato back into potato scallops, the Fich potato scallop ($3/each) celebrates the Sebago encasing it in thin, crisp batter against tomato sauce. We upgraded to garlic sauce ($3) and had an improved experience.Harvey Bay scallops ($6/each) served on the half-shell with vermicelli noodles and XO sauce wanted for some golden caramelisation. Fich popcorn ($16) was the piece of genius. Sriracha and maple sauce replicates Korean fried chicken treatments using battered nuggets of fish, finished with shallots and sesame seeds. While you’d think it would drink best with white sangria ($28/carafe) it was actually the offerings on the short but thoughtful wine list that delivered best: a French 2018 Clomarin Picpoul de Pinet ($9/glass) and an off-dry 2018 Thanisch Kabinett Riesling ($10/glass) as the sangria was a bit boring. We ended our meal with pan roasted calamari ($25). While the pale calamari was beautifully soft (rather than rubbery), the promised garlic and chilli was so muted it was lost when eaten against the accompanying charred flatbread.
